Day 4 of slalom competition at the 2008 Olympic Games

Day 4 of the Beijing Olympic Slalom Competition was cut short by torrential rain and thunderstorms. Spectators crowded the upper tiers of the stands in a rainbow of pastel plastic raincoats as athletes warmed up and the C2s raced their Semifinal. The Hochschorner brothers of Slovakia had one touch, and are in close contention with Germans Michel/Piersig at the top of the Semifinal results.

Sporadic lightning and thunder mixed with steady heavy rain finally resulted in postponement of the competition.
